Purpose: compute AA from RR, rr in Geometry via A=pi(R2r2)A=\\pi(R^2-r^2) Washer area. Use it when a real geometry question must be answered in SI before a code check.

Live realistic example

In symbols

Live case. Given R=3.000mR = 3.000\,\mathrm{m}, r=1.500mr = 1.500\,\mathrm{m}, the governing relation A=pi(R2r2)A=\\pi(R^2-r^2) yields A=21.206m2A = 21.206\,\mathrm{m^{2}}.
